Vesperae
The Evening Hour of the Cross
Christ is taken down from the cross at evening, his suffering revealed as the hidden medicine of life and his thorn-crown of glory brought low.
He is taken down from the cross; evening has come. Strength lay hidden in the divine mind. Such a death he underwent—the medicine of life. Alas, the crown of glory lay low—a thorn.
Adoration of the Redeeming Cross
The soul adores Christ and blesses him because through his holy cross he has redeemed the world.
We adore you, Christ, and we bless you. Because through your holy cross you have redeemed the world.
A Plea Before the Judgment Seat
A fervent prayer asks Christ to set his suffering, cross, and death as atonement before God's judgment for the living, the dead, and the church, concluding with a doxological Amen.
Lord Jesus Christ, Son of the living God, place your suffering, cross, and death between your judgment and my soul, now and in the hour of my death, and deign to grant mercy and grace to the living, rest and pardon to the dead, peace and harmony to your holy church, and to us sinners life and everlasting joy. You, who live and reign, God. Through all ages of ages. Amen.
Read the original Latin
De cruce deponitur hora vespertina fortitudo latuit in mente divina. Talem mortem subiit vite medicina. Heu corona glorie iacuit spina.
Adoramus te xpriste et benedicimus tibi. Quia per sanctam crucem tuam redemisti mundum.
Domine ihesu xpriste filii dei vivi pone passionem crucem et mortem tuam inter iudicium tuum et animam meam nunc et in hora mortis mee et largiri digneris vivis misericordiam et gratiam defunctis requiem et veniam ecclesie tue sancte pacem et concordiam et nobis peccatoribus vitam et letitiam sempiternam. Qui vivis et regnas deus. Per omnia secula seculorum. Amen.
